Temporal and Multimodal Deep Learning for Cyberattack Detection in LEO Satellite Systems
תקציר מקורי באנגליתarXiv:2609.10746v1 Announce Type: cross Abstract: The growing reliance on Low-Earth Orbit (LEO) satellite communication systems has increased the need for intelligent methods capable of detecting cyberattacks across complex and dynamic space environments. Unlike conventional network intrusion detection, satellite systems generate heterogeneous information across radio-frequency (RF) links, onboard hardware, and orbital operations. However, many existing approaches either rely on terrestrial intrusion datasets or evaluate individual observations independently, limiting their ability to capture temporal attack behavior specific to LEO satellites.
